WebMar 5, 2024 · It's called preshaping because it's the step right before you shape the dough into whatever your end loaf will be: a batard, a boule, a baguette, etc. At a high level, preshaping bread dough: Adds strength to the dough. Prepares the dough into a form for easier and more consistent final shaping. Creates a tighter, uniform surface on the dough. WebScoring is not just to make a visually pretty design on the top of a loaf. It is also how the baker controls the direction in which the loaf expands. This impacts the shape of the loaf cross section (rounder or more oval), the height of the loaf and, for a boule, whether it stays round or ends up more oblong. WebMay 21, 2024 · First and foremost, I recommend a separate oven thermometer to ensure that your oven is well calibrated (ovens can be off by as much as 25+ degrees) and adjusting temperatures as necessary. If this continues to be an issue, try placing a baking sheet (or two stacked baking sheets) under your baking vessel to add some extra insulation.

WebAdd plenty of steam by pouring a cup of boiling water into the baking tray and quickly shut the door. Drop the temperature to 230C (440F). After 20 – 25 minutes, open the oven door to release the steam and consider dropping the temperature down to 210 – 200C (410 – 390F) if the crust is already well coloured.
